#!/usr/bin/perl
#print "yo";exit;
require "/home/httpd/grainnet4/ssjs/info/functions.pl";
sub get_header {
$type = shift;
if ($type eq "nspart2") {
print "Northern Star II - Fiction Series";
} elsif ($type eq "ot") {
print "Old Time Elevator";
}
}
if ($request::type) {$TYPE = $request::type;}
elsif ($request::keyword) {$TYPE = $request::keyword;}
else {$TYPE = "bn";}
if ($request::view) {$view = $request::view;}
$viewcount=substr($view, 3, length($view));
if($viewcount) {
$nextset = $viewcount+1;
} else {
$nextset=1;
}
print<
// Opens the article lib.
function openAL(AID) {
Articles = window.open("http://www.grainnet.com/intranet/Articles/index.php?ID="+AID,
"Articles","menubar=0,toolbar=0,location=0,directories=0,status=0,scrollbars=0,resizable=1,width=770,height=710");
Articles.focus();
}
THEEND
get_header($TYPE);
print <
|
THEEND
if ($TYPE ne "fp" && $TYPE ne "nspart2" && $TYPE ne "ns") { print getIncludeFile('monday_friday'); }
print<
THEEND
print getArticles($TYPE, $view, $request::dayoffset, $request::offset, $request::articleoffset, $request::keyword);
#print "type: ".$request::type." TYPE: $TYPE view: $view";
print<
|
|
THEEND
if ($request::dayoffset != null) {
print getIncludeFile('monday_friday');
} elsif ($request::articleoffset) {
print 'View more articles
';
} else {
if (!($TYPE eq "ns" || $TYPE eq "mm" || $TYPE eq "library") && $view ne "all" && $nextset < 100 && $viewmore==1) {
print 'View more articles
';
}
}
print<
|
|
|
THEEND